如果我使用一个“ChangeDetector”转换器,并将Smallworld Reader alternative“a”、checkpoint“B”作为原始阅读器、Smallworld Reader alternative“a”作为修改后的阅读器,那么它将为我找到被删除的对象。但是这将使转换变得很长,因为它需要扫描表两次才能找到删除。我注意到被删除记录的fme_db_operations没有值,不确定这是否是基线导出不能识别被删除记录的原因。
Smallworld中的差异读取器将使用INSERT、UPDATE或DELETE填充属性fme_db_operation。
您可以使用该属性(需要公开它)来测试删除。